What's the Deal with Positive Space?

Let's kick things off with positive space, shall we? In simple terms, positive space is the area of an image or design where the subject matter or main elements are placed. It's the stuff you're intentionally putting on your canvas, so to speak. Think of it as the hero of your design – the main character that draws the viewer's eye.

Positive space is what you want your audience to focus on. It's the message you're conveying through your design. For instance, in a logo, the positive space is the brand's symbol, name, or both. In a landscape painting, it's the mountains, trees, and rivers.

Understanding Positive Space: A Few Tips

  1. 1. Keep it clear: Make sure your positive space is easy to understand and recognize. It should be the first thing viewers see and grasp.
  2. 2. Use contrast: To make your positive space pop, surround it with contrasting colors, shapes, or textures. This helps draw the eye in.
  3. 3. Play with scale: Size matters! Bigger elements in positive space naturally draw more attention.

The Art of Negative Space

Now, let's talk about negative space. You might think it's just the empty area around your design, but negative space is so much more! It's the space that surrounds and defines your positive space. It's the background, the supporting cast, the unsung hero that makes your design work.

Negative space might seem passive, but it's incredibly active. It guides the viewer's eye, sets the mood, and can even create illusions. Think of those optical illusions where you see one image, then suddenly, it changes into something else. That's negative space at work!

Mastering Negative Space: A Few Tips

  1. 1. Balance is key: A balanced negative space helps create harmony in your design. Too much or too little can throw things off.
  2. 2. Use it to your advantage: Negative space can create secondary images or messages. It's a sneaky way to add depth and intrigue to your design.
  3. 3. Play with perception: Negative space can make elements seem to float, recede, or pop out. Experiment with this to create interesting visual effects.

Positive Space and Negative Space: A Match Made in Heaven

When positive space and negative space work together, they create a powerful visual dynamic. They play off each other, creating balance, tension, and intrigue. Here are a few ways to make the most of this dynamic duo:

  1. 1. Frame your subject: Use negative space to frame your positive space. This draws attention to the main subject and creates a sense of importance.
  2. 2. Create contrast: Juxtapose your positive space against a contrasting negative space to make it stand out.
  3. 3. Play with balance: Balance your positive space with your negative space to create a sense of harmony. But remember, balance isn't always about equal amounts – sometimes, a little tension can be interesting!
